***********************
** FILE NAME : acltest.cpp
** SYSTEM NAME : AXE - Andromeda X-windows Encapsulation
-** VERSION NUMBER : $Revision: 1.5 $
+** VERSION NUMBER : $Revision: 1.6 $
**
** DESCRIPTION : Test routine for non-X classes
**
/*****************************
$Log: acltest.cpp,v $
- Revision 1.5 2002-11-03 13:19:33 arjen
+ Revision 1.6 2002-11-04 07:25:00 arjen
+ Use proper namespace for iostream classes
+
+ Revision 1.5 2002/11/03 13:19:33 arjen
New functions - String::escape() and String::unescape()
Revision 1.4 2002/09/26 14:48:46 arjen
*****************************/
-static const char *RCSID = "$Id: acltest.cpp,v 1.5 2002-11-03 13:19:33 arjen Exp $";
+static const char *RCSID = "$Id: acltest.cpp,v 1.6 2002-11-04 07:25:00 arjen Exp $";
#include "String.h"
-#include "integer.h"
#include "date.h"
int main()
std::cout << x << " >> 3 = " << y << "\n";
std::cout << "\nInput a string:\n";
- cin >> hello;
+ std::cin >> hello;
std::cout << hello << "\n\n";
std::cout << "\nAnd another one:\n";
- cin >> pattern;
+ std::cin >> pattern;
std::cout << pattern << "\n\n";
std::cout << "Second string found at position " << pattern.in(hello);
std::cout << " of first string.\n";
std::cout << x.escape() << "\n";
}
- std::cout << "***********************\nInteger Test\n*********************\n";
- integer a(2000000000), b(2048);
- integer c;
-
- std::cout << "a = " << a << ", b = " << b << "\n";
- std::cout << "c = " << c << "\n";
- c = b;
- std::cout << "c = b : c = " << c << "\n";
-
std::cout << "***********************\nDate Test\n*********************\n";
date d1, d2(22,7,1964);
String datestring;
- cin >> datestring;
+ std::cin >> datestring;
d2 = date(datestring);
std::cout << datestring << " parses into (DD-MM-YYYY): " << d2 << "\n";
std::cout << "With 10,50,30: " << t1 << "\n";
std::cout << "Enter a time: \n";
- cin >> datestring;
+ std::cin >> datestring;
t2 = hour(datestring);
std::cout << datestring << " parses into (HH:MM:SS): " << t2 << "\n";